Social Security Schemes for Senior Citizens, Widows and Persons with Disabilities (NSAP 2026)

Who needs this service? (Eligibility) Senior Citizens: Age 60+ years, living Below Poverty Line (BPL). Widows: Age 40+ years, living Below Poverty Line (BPL). Persons with Disabilities: Age 18+ years, 80% or more disability, living Below Poverty Line (BPL). Required Documents Keep these ready before applying. pm kisan yojana how to apply edit details and check instalment status

PM Kisan Yojana: How to Apply, Edit Details and Check Instalment Status

PM Kisan Yojana: How to Apply, Edit Details and Check Instalment Status Who needs this service? Eligible: All landholding farmer families (Husband, Wife, Minor Children) with cultivable land in their names. Excluded: Institutional landholders, Income Tax payers, serving/retired govt employees (Group A/B/C), professionals (Doctors, Engineers, Lawyers), and pensioners with monthly pension >₹10,000.
